Useful projector stand that can be used in many different ways

I wanted to order a projector stand because the makeshift stand I'm using isn't the best and I think it's dangerous. This device consisted of a microphone stand to which the top of a music stand was attached. This causes obvious problems due to the fragile way it is configured. With this very nice stand with arm extension option for projectors, I found a solution to not having to worry about collisions with the tripod microphone stand I'm using. This mounting fixture also gives my setup a professional look. It can be used in any way imaginable to make it work for you. Ideally you want to use this with a projector that has mounting holes at the top. The projector I used did not have holes to use the included extension cord that comes with this mechanism. My projector has a threaded hole in the bottom center. What I did was not attach the four extensions or supports for the intended installation but left the main mounting plate bare. I then enlarged the screw hole intended for one of the extensions. After that I was able to screw in a thick screw that fits into the bottom mounting hole under the machine. For additional stabilization of the device, I used a reliable wide stabilizer that can be unscrewed. They're on every projector I've ever used and they're always a life saver. With this screw I placed the projected image in the center of the screen. The center main shaft slides out when you need extra leverage. I didn't need it so I hid it. I removed two tiny screws holding the bracket to the base of the wall. This allowed me to raise my hand just enough to set the initial centering of the projected image. Then I just stuck a thin drill bit into the hole of the two holes where the screws I just removed were. After that, I was left with an easily adjustable stabilizer. I feel that the metal used in this device is of good quality. I believe in its durability and I think it will last a long time. In conclusion, I had fun finding a way to use the mounting mechanism. I recommend this projector stand for both home and professional presentations.
